In October 2009 Nick Klassen of North Bay died suddenly from complications due to the H1N1 virus.
He was 23 years old.
Nick grew up in North Bay and was a graduate of West Ferris Secondary School. He believed that change begins with positive thinking, communication and being socially brave enough to lend a hand to your neighbour. In recognition of this, Plaid Shirt Society (made up of friends and family) hosts an annual fundraiser for not-for-profit organizations that place emphasis on building strong communities and pushing the boundaries of social awareness and involvement.
The Plaid Shirt Society is a Third Party fundraising group that will host its 8th annual charity fundraising event in North Bay this year, in memory of Klassen.
